MaintainJ 3.2

MaintainJ Inc. in Development / Compilers & Interpreters

MaintainJ screenshot

User Rating: 3.3 (28 votes)

MaintainJ, an Eclipse plug-in, generates runtime UML sequence and class diagrams for a given use case, helping the users to quickly understand a complex Java or J2EE application.

MaintainJ logs runtime method call trace to a file and uses that trace file to render sequence and class diagrams. MaintainJ is the tool to turn to when :

· You want to find out what exactly happens in the application when you run a use case.
· You need to quickly understand large, complex Java applications.
· You want to reduce the maintenance costs by more than 20%.

This software will turn out to be different from any reverse engineering tools you have seen before. MaintainJ comes with a web application (MaintainJ.war) and three Eclipse plug-ins.

NOTE: You will need to register to obtain a trial key. Otherwise, MaintainJ will work in a limited evaluation mode in which sequence diagram calls can be expanded or collapsed for a limited number of times.

FEATURES:

· Forget Static Reverse Engineering - UML diagrams from source code can take you only so far. Run a use case and generate UML sequence and class diagrams for that use case to debug and understand complex systems.

· Save the Time Spent in Debugger - Debuggers help. But they are tiresome. Save the time you must spend in the debugger by first reading the runtime UML diagrams to get an overview.

· Explore the Diagrams - MaintainJ sequence diagrams are a pleasure to read. You can expand and collapse the calls while exploring a complex sequence diagram.

· Focus on What You Need - Only application classes (no API calls) are shown in diagrams. All loop calls and recursive calls are removed from sequence diagrams.

· Generate. Do Not Draw - Code is the truth. Run the code and generate UML whenever you need.

· Save Maintenance Costs - Development costs 10%. Maintenance costs 90%. Understanding code costs 50% of maintenance costs. Save by generating UML diagrams that help you to quickly understand code.

· Open Source Based - MaintainJ is an Eclipse based product. Buy it or just use and blog it. Or tell us about a more useful product for those who support and maintain complex Java applications.

File Size: 6.7001953125 MB License: Shareware Price: $100.00
Platform: Windows XP, Windows Vista, Windows Vista x64, Windows 7, Windows 7 x64
Downloads: Total: 139 | This Month: 0 Released: 2011-09-19
MaintainJ Similar Software

Eclipse SDK x64 4.7.1a Eclipse Foundation, Inc.    

Eclipse SDK is an open source platform-independent software framework ... (JDT) and compiler that come as part of Eclipse SDK (and which are also used to develop Eclipse itself). However, it can be used for other ... the popular BitTorrent client Azureus for example. Eclipse SDK was originally developed by IBM, but is .... Free download of Eclipse SDK x64 4.7.1a

Eclipse SDK 4.7.1a Eclipse Foundation, Inc.    

Eclipse SDK is an open source platform-independent software framework ... clients perform heavy-duty work on the host. The Eclipse software development environment provides programmers with the means ... platform, Standard Widget Toolkit (SWT), JFace, and the Eclipse Workbench for viewing and editing perspectives. The Modeling ... consists of several official project categories of the Eclipse Foundation that set their sights on model-based development .... Free download of Eclipse SDK 4.7.1a

PB DeCompiler v2013.06.30 chengang    

.... Free download of PB DeCompiler v2013.06.30

Boomerang for Windows 0.3.1 Alpha The Boomerang Decompiler Project    

A general, open source, retargetable decompiler of machine code programs This project is an attempt to develop a real decompiler for machine code programs through the open source community. A decompiler takes as input an executable file, and attempts ... file and makes an executable. However, a general decompiler does not attempt to reverse every action of .... Free download of Boomerang for Windows 0.3.1 Alpha

software pick   

Boomerang for Linux 0.3 Alpha The Boomerang Decompiler Project    

A general, open source, retargetable decompiler of machine code programs This project is an attempt to develop a real decompiler for machine code programs through the open source community. A decompiler takes as input an executable file, and attempts ... file and makes an executable. However, a general decompiler does not attempt to reverse every action of .... Free download of Boomerang for Linux 0.3 Alpha

software pick   
Popular Software in Development / Compilers & Interpreters

Fiddler 4.6.20173.38786 Eric Lawrence    

A useful HTTP Debugging Proxy that logs all HTTP traffic between your computer. Free download of Fiddler 4.6.20173.38786

software pick   

PureBasic x64 5.61 Fantaisie Software    

A programming language that is based on established BASIC rules. Free download of PureBasic x64 5.61

software pick   

PB DeCompiler v2013.06.30 chengang    

PowerBuilder DeCompiler and PBD Decompiler. Free download of PB DeCompiler v2013.06.30

Wing IDE Personal 6.0.8-2 Reva66e Wingware     update

An integrated development environment (IDE) for the Python programming language. Free download of Wing IDE Personal 6.0.8-2 Reva66e

software pick   

SCAR Divi 3.38.01 Frédéric Hannes    

A program designed to automate repetitive tasks on your computer. Free download of SCAR Divi 3.38.01